+ | ===== Phone Skills ===== | ||
+ | |||
+ | * **Confidence & Clarity** - The agent must speak clearly with confidence. There should be no chewing or rustling, with minimal use of filler words such as " | ||
+ | * **Understanding** - The agent is responsible for asking questions to ensure that they understand why the customer is calling in. | ||
+ | * **Active Listening** - The agent must be paying attention so that the customer does not have to repeat themselves. They should not interrupt or speak over the customer. | ||
+ | * **Silence** - There should be no more than 15 seconds of silence without the agent speaking; unless they have set a longer time period with the customer. | ||
+ | |||
+ | **Talk Track:** //I will need 1-2 minutes to review your account with us. Please bear with me for a moment.// | ||
+ | |||
+ | * **Hold** - The agent should check in with the customer at least every 2 minutes. They should always thank the customer for holding. | ||
+ | * **Etiquette** - Agents must always speak politely and with respect to customers. | ||

+ | ===== Hot Caller ===== | ||
+ | |||
+ | * **Empathize and de-escalate** - If a customer is upset or angry, acknowledge their feelings and make an offer to help resolve their issue. | ||
+ | |||
+ | **Talk Track:** //I am very sorry to hear that you are upset and I understand your concern. Let me see what I can do to get this resolved for you.// | ||
